Какво прави LDR в lc3?
Какво прави LDR в lc3?

Видео: Какво прави LDR в lc3?

Видео: Какво прави LDR в lc3?
Видео: Любовь и голуби (FullHD, комедия, реж. Владимир Меньшов, 1984 г.) 2024, Ноември
Anonim

LDR съхранява стойността на източника на регистъра плюс непосредствено изместване на стойността и го съхранява в регистъра на местоназначението. LDI третира изходния регистър като адрес и съхранява съдържанието на паметта на този адрес в регистъра на местоназначението. Тази функция съхранява стойност (етикет на източника) в регистър на местоназначението.

Като се има предвид това, какво прави STR в lc3?

Тази функция съхранява стойност (етикет на източника) в регистър на местоназначението. ул съхранява стойността в регистър източник в регистър местоназначение. Може да се използва и незабавно изместване.

Второ, колко бита се използват за идентифициране на изместването на програмния брояч в lc3 инструкция? В LC-3 ISA има 15 инструкции , всеки идентифицирани чрез своя уникален операционен код. Операционният код се определя от битове [15:12] от инструкция . От четири се използват битове за да посочите кода на операцията, са възможни 16 различни операционни кода. както и да е LC-3 ISA определя само 15 операционни кода.

По същия начин какво прави.fill в lc3?

попълнете : казва на асемблера, сложете тези битове в дума.. низ: конвертиране на текст в. ПЪЛНЕТЕ с един ascii код на дума, прекратен с NUL.

Каква е работата на ST инструкцията?

Операция [редактиране] ST инструкция приема 32-битовата целочислена стойност, съдържаща се в изходния регистър, определен от първия аргумент, и съхранява тази стойност в адреса на паметта, определен от втория аргумент (целевия адрес).

Препоръчано: